We welcomed Deux Punx tonight. They started in 2006 as a small garage project in San Francisco and since grown into a Napa-based operation. They source fruit from organic andbiodynamic growers and focus on minimal intervention in the cellar. May Wrap-Up 🌷

May was a month of community connections and meaningful conversations for the Sonoma Valley Woman’s Club.

We were honored to welcome Sandy Sanchez, Programs Director, and Dennis Agnos, Development Director from La Luz Center, who shared insights into the important work being done at La Luz, current community needs, and ways we can support their mission.

We also celebrated the SVWC Foundation being recognized as the Tuesday Night Market Nonprofit Spotlight, along with a live interview on our local radio station 91.3 KSVY. What a wonderful opportunity to share our history, mission, and impact with the broader community.
